
Evidence and decision provenance graphs
046-evidence-provenance-graph.RdEvidence and decision provenance graphs. These functions form the eyeprocess 0.6.0.9000 measurement-intelligence programme and use dependency-free reference implementations with explicit evidence limits.
Usage
build_evidence_graph(raw_data, transformations = NULL, metrics = NULL,
models = NULL, diagnostics = NULL, decisions = NULL, edges = NULL)
trace_item_decision(graph, item_id)
compare_decision_provenance(graph_a, graph_b)
audit_evidence_dependencies(graph)
plot_evidence_graph(x, ...)
plot_item_decision_path(x, ...)
plot_metric_dependency_graph(x, ...)
plot_model_decision_impact(x, ...)Arguments

Details
The APIs return auditable S3 objects. Plot wrappers call registered base-graphics methods. Experimental or approximate engines are labelled in object status fields and should be validated before confirmatory or operational use.
Value
An eyeprocess result object, data frame, model object, plot, or audit table as documented by the individual function.
